Geister Duo take their name from Robert Schumann's last piano work, the Geistervariationen, whose theme Brahms, a close friend of the Schumanns, used to compose his own Variations Op.23 for piano four hands. This recording proposes a bridge between these two composers. The record is rounded out with Dvor�k's Bohemian Forests (Aus Dem B�hmerwalde). A relatively unknown work, it is for the duo, a masterpieces full of folk inspiration and rich in a variety of colors of the twilight of the 19th century.
